About This Item

A little foxing here and there, and some fraying of the spine heads and heels, but all pages clean and tight. One foldout has two small tears.

Arguably the greatest diary in English by possibly the world's greatest diarist. This is Henry B Wheatley's 1896/1897 10-volume publication (the diary in 8 volumes, plus the index published in 1924 and the Pepysiana published in 1928). This is the diary the world knew until Robert Latham's and William Matthews' nine-volume definitive edition of 1970-1983.

These eight volumes of the diary belonged to and bear the bookplates of Duke Georg Alexander of Mecklenburg-Strelitz (1859-1909), eldest son of Grand Duchess Catherine Mikhailovna and a cousin of Emperor Alexander III of Russia. He was a Major General in the Russian Army, a skilled musician and the founder of the Mecklenburg Quartet.
